Saint Vincent and the Grenadines, a picturesque archipelago in the Caribbean, boasts a rich cultural tapestry woven from its African, Carib, and European heritage. The island nation’s history of colonization and slavery has fostered a resilient and close-knit community, where family and communal ties are paramount. Vincentians place a high value on mutual support, hospitality, and a laid-back lifestyle, reflecting the island’s serene environment. The societal norms emphasize respect for elders, strong family bonds, and a collective approach to problem-solving. The vibrant festivals, music, and dance traditions, such as the annual Vincy Mas carnival, are not just celebrations but also expressions of the island’s historical struggles and triumphs, reinforcing a shared sense of identity and pride.

Introverts are often characterized by their preference for solitude and deep, meaningful interactions over large social gatherings. They are perceived as thoughtful, introspective, and highly self-aware individuals who excel in environments that allow for quiet reflection and focused work. Their strengths include a remarkable ability to listen and empathize, making them excellent confidants and advisors. However, introverts may face challenges such as feeling drained by excessive social interaction and struggling to assert themselves in highly extroverted settings. Despite these hurdles, introverts cope with adversity by drawing on their inner reserves of resilience and creativity, often finding innovative solutions to problems. Their distinctive qualities, such as a keen attention to detail and a propensity for thorough analysis, make them invaluable in roles that require deep concentration and strategic thinking.
